> The test will fail if the tests methods don't run in the order they are defined in the class file. JUnit does not actually run the tests in any sort of well defined order, as the Java compiler does not preserve order information when it compiles the class files.
> As the actual order is semi-random the test fails intermittently (I notice it on OpenJDK).
